qflag: Q methodology: automatic flagging of Q-sorts
Description
Applies the two standard algorithms to flag Q-sorts automatically, for posterior calculation of the statement scores.
Usage
qflag(loa, nstat)
Arguments
loa
a Q-sort factor loading matrix obtained from unclass(principal(...)$loadings).
nstat
number of statements in the study.
Details
These are the two standard criteria for automatic flagging used in Q method analysis:
Q-sorts which factor loading is higher than the threshold for p-value > 0.95, and
Q-sorts which square loading is higher than the sum of square loadings of the same Q-sort in all other factors.
